WisdomTree Bitcoin ETF Reports Zero Daily Flow

WisdomTree Bitcoin ETF Reports Zero Daily Flow

According to Farside Investors, the Bitcoin ETF managed by WisdomTree reported a daily flow of US$0, indicating no new capital inflow or outflow on that specific date. This stagnation in flow could influence short-term trading strategies as it suggests a lack of immediate investor interest or market movement in the WisdomTree Bitcoin ETF.
